欢迎来到天天文库
浏览记录
ID:56990467
大小:483.50 KB
页数:28页
时间:2020-07-25
《微机原理及应用第3章1节课件.ppt》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库。
1、3.在计算机内部,一切信息的存取、处理和传送都是以()形式进行的。A.BCD码B.ASCII码C.十六进制D.二进制4.下面几个不同进制的无符号数中,最大的数是()。A.1100010BB.225QC.500D.1FEH5.下面几个不同进制的不带符号数中,最小的数是()。A.1001001BB.75QC.37QD.0A7H6.十进制数-75用二进制数10110101表示,其表示方法是()A.原码B.补码C.反码D.ASCII码1.下列各个二进制数的补码中,绝对值最大的是()A.10001000BB.11111110BC.00000100BD.00000001B2.对数值83A7
2、H作逻辑非运算后的结果是()A.83A8HB.73A8HC.7C59HD.7C58HADDBDC1时间:2010—9月8日(第二周周三)本次课内容:1、CPU功能。2、8086的功能结构。3、8086寄存器结构。本次课重点:1、通用寄存器的用法、特定用途。2、标志状态寄存器各位的含义。2第3章80x86微处理器3.180x86微处理器简介3.28086/8088微处理器3.38086/8088存储器和I/O组织380x86微处理器是美国Intel公司生产的系列微处理器。该公司成立于1968年,1969年就设计了4位的4004芯片,1973年开发出8位的8080芯片,1978年正
3、式推出16位的8086微处理器芯片。。3.1微处理器简介4表3.180x86系列微处理器概况3.1微处理器简介5表3.180x86系列微处理器概况3.1微处理器简介68086是Intel系列的16位微处理器,芯片上有2.9万个晶体管,用单一的+5V电源,时钟频率为5MHz~10MHz。8086有16根数据线和20根地址线,它既能处理16位数据,也能处理8位数据。可寻址的内存空间为1MB。220=1k×1k=1MB。8088有8位数据线,与地址线A0-A7兼用;7微处理器的内部结构从应用角度(不是从内部工作原理)展开典型8位微处理器的基本结构8088/8086的功能结构8088/
4、8086的寄存器结构8088/8086的存储器结构为学习指令系统打好基础83.28086/8088的功能结构8086CPU功能结构分成两部分:总线接口部件BIU:总线接口单元BIU,负责控制存贮器读写。执行部件EU:执行单元EU从指令队列中取出指令并执行。特点:取指部分和执行指令部分分开进行,提高了速度。9执行部件总线接口部件通用寄存器四个专用寄存器SP:堆栈指针,其内容与堆栈段寄存器SS的内容一起,提供堆栈操作地址。BP:基址指针:构成段内偏移地址的一部分.SI:(SourceIndex):SI含有源地址意思,产生有效地址或实际地址的偏移量。DI:(DestinationIn
5、dex):DI含有目的意思,产生有效地址或实际地址的偏移量。算术逻辑单元ALU:主要是加法器。大部分指令的执行由加法器完成。标志寄存器:16位字利用了9位。标志分两类:状态标志(6位):反映刚刚完成的操作结果情况。控制标志(3位):在某些指令操作中起控制作用。1020位地址加法器四个段寄存器:CS、DS、SS、ESCS管理代码段;DS管理数据段SS管理堆栈段;ES管理附加段.16位的指令指针寄存器IP:IP中的内容是下一条指令对现行代码段基地址的偏移量,6字节的指令队列指令队列共六字节,总线接口部件BIU从内存取指令,取来的总是放在指令队列中;执行部件EU从指令队列取指令,并执
6、行。118088的指令执行过程121、总线接口部件BIU(BusInterfaceUnit)组成:16位段寄存器,指令指针,20位地址加法器,总线控制逻辑,6字节指令队列。作用:负责从内存指定单元中取出指令,送入指令流队列中排队;取出指令所需的操作数送EU单元去执行。工作过程:由段寄存器与IP形成20位物理地址送地址总线,由总线控制电路发出存储器“读”信号,按给定的地址从存储器中取出指令,送到指令队列中等待执行。*当指令队列有2个或2个以上的字节空余时,BIU自动将指令取到指令队列中。若遇到转移指令等,则将指令队列清空,BIU重新取新地址中的指令代码,送入指令队列。*指令指针I
7、P由BIU自动修改,IP总是指向下一条将要执行指令的地址。132、指令执行部件EU(ExectionUnit)组成:通用寄存器,标志寄存器,ALU,EU控制系统等。作用:负责指令的执行,完成指令的操作。工作过程:从队列中取得指令,进行译码,根据指令要求向EU内部各部件发出控制命令,完成执行指令的功能。若执行指令需要访问存储器或I/O端口,则EU将操作数的偏移地址送给BIU,由BIU取得操作数送给EU。143、8086CPU结构的特点:减少了CPU为取指令而等待的时间,提高了CPU的运行速度。
此文档下载收益归作者所有